Applies To: Windows Vista,Windows Server 2008,Windows Server 2008 R2
Retrieves the display name of the specified job.
Syntax
![]() | |
---|---|
bitsadmin /GetDisplayName <Job> |
Parameters
Parameter | Description |
---|---|
Job |
The job's display name or GUID |
Examples
The following example retrieves the display name for the job named myDownloadJob.
![]() | |
---|---|
C:\>bitsadmin /GetDisplayName myDownloadJob |
